The Retirement Planning Center

The Retirement Planning Center is a US-based registered investment advisor (RIA) specializing in retirement-phase portfolio construction. The firm serves individuals and families transitioning from accumulation to decumulation, offering financial planning, investment management, and estate coordination. Its investment approach centers on low-cost index-based portfolios combined with income-generating assets such as dividend stocks, municipal bonds, and annuities. The firm explicitly models sequence-of-returns risk and adjusts asset allocation as clients age. Services include Roth IRA conversions, required minimum distribution planning, and long-term care insurance evaluation. The firm operates from a single office and relies on a team of certified financial planners and advisors. No publicly disclosed professionals list is available. The firm does not manage capital for institutional allocators or operate a family-office division. The Retirement Planning Center structures itself as a fiduciary under the Investment Advisers Act of 1940. Its core differentiator is a systematic decumulation methodology — mapping a client's life expectancy to a glidepath of reduced equity exposure and optimized tax timing.
